The Macroscopic Material Behavior Of Concrete
The macroscopic material behavior of concrete is influenced by the geometry, spatial distribution and
material properties of individual material constituents and their mutual interactions. Therefore, it is
essential to study the influence of each material constituent in order to estimate the residual strength of
the structural components. Thus, failure of concrete is a complex phenomenon due to its multiscale
and multiphase nature. When the normal stress in a material reaches its tensile strength, the
inhomogeneities in concrete promote the formation of an inelastic zone ahead of an existing crack
termed as the fracture process zone (FPZ). The FPZ is dominated by various complicated mechanisms
such as crack shielding, crack deflection, aggregate bridging and microcracking around the crack tip
and exhibits a post peak softening behavior under tensile loading. It therefore becomes necessary to
include these effects for predicting reasonably well the residual strength of existing cracked and
damaged structures.
Bridging of coarse aggregate occurs when the crack advances beyond an aggregate that continues to
transmit stress across the crack until it ruptures or is pulled out. The bridging aggregate may be
considered to exert a closing pressure on the crack surface thereby resisting the crack growth and its
magnitude strongly depends on the interfacial properties between coarse aggregate and cement mortar.
Upon loading of plain concrete beams under three point bending, it is

Windows Xp Architecture Vs. Mac Os X Architecture Essay...
Windows XP vs. Mac OS X Architecture
When looking at the interface of the Mac OS X Operating System and the Microsoft Windows XP
operating system many similarities can be seen. The most obvious is the use of blue in the interface. In
the core of the systems they both have a micro kernel which addresses thread management, space
management and other communications at the system level and is more resistant to attacks from a
virus.
Mac OS X is a powerful development platform; it supports multiple development technologies like
UNIX, Java, Cocoa and Carbon. It also is host to many open source, web, scripting, database and
development technologies. It was build around the integrated stack of graphics and media
technologies such as QuickTime, 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
Among the Aqua user interface, Apple also built in Pre emptive multitasking and memory protection
to improve the ability of the operating system to run multiple applications simultaneously without
interrupting or corrupting each other. The system can also determine how much RAM should be used
for each running application and it can also determine how much of the processor needs to be devoted
to the running applications. For example if a picture is being rendered in Photoshop in the background
and a user is surfing the web in the foreground, the system will automatically put more of the
processors power to the Photoshop application to get the requested job done.
Apple also wants as many developers as it can get for the Operating System; therefore they have
created development tools that are included with every copy of the system. One of the most notable
programs that is included is called Xcode. Xcode provides interfaces to compilers that support several
programming languages such as C, C++ and Java. Because Apple is also in a transition from the
PowerPC RISC processor to the Intel X86 processor the Xcode application can compile code for
either or both processors, making the compiled application a Universal Binary application.
Windows XP has a microkernel that sits between the Hardware Abstraction Layer and the executive, it
provides multiprocessor synchronization, thread and interrupt scheduling and

Since 1994, the number of American adults over 50 who are providing care to their parents has tripled
and now exceeds 10 million (National Institute on Aging 2008). At the same time, paid eldercare has
become big business. Total annual revenues have been estimated at $264 billion (Freedonia Group
2008), of which 54% went to in home care services and assisted living in 2006 (Reuters 2008). While
much in home care is medical care, nonmedical assistance is also common. In 2000, over 378,000
Americans over age 75 were receiving paid, in home assistance with daily activities such as shopping,
transportation, and grooming that fall outside of the category of medical care (National Center for
Health Statistics 2004). Some older adults hire paid care providers because they have no family or
friends available to provide assistance, but most paid caregivers join an existing group of family
members or friends who are already helping the older person. The composition of this group and the
types of assistance members provide has been shown to change over time as the older person s needs
and members circumstances change (Peek and Zsembik 1997; Waldrop 2006). The group of people
that helps an older person to consume has yet to be considered by marketing scholars. Previous studies
of group consumption have focused on the nuclear family (Davis 1976; Palan and

Liquidity And Liquidity Risk Management Essay
Liquidity and Liquidity Risk Assets come in many forms, differentiating in their liquidity. Liquidity,
by definition, is how easy an asset can be traded (Hertrich, 2015). Different assets have different
abilities to be traded, cash being the easiest; hence cash is the most liquid asset. This causes price
differentiation, where more liquid assets have higher price tags and lower trading costs (Hertrich,
2015). This makes more liquid assets more attractive for investors. When assets have low liquidity
there are risks involved for investors because there is a chance that the asset cannot be turned into cash
when needed. Liquidity risk calculates the difficulty of selling an asset in return for cash (Currie,
2011). Liquidity risk is associated with low liquidity; hence there is a negative relationship between
liquidity and liquidity risk (Hertrich, 2015). This implies that the higher the liquidity risk of the asset,
the less the possibility the asset can be traded.
Typically, financial markets in developed countries are liquid; however, in the US during the Global
Financial Crisis [GFC], many homeowners were unable to sell their houses due to declining prices and
falling demand, so the housing market became illiquid (Currie, 2011). The GFC demonstrated how
volatile liquidity can be and that liquidity disruption could be system wide, seen by its global effect
(Bessis, 2015). During the GFC, there was also a systemic bank crisis. At a bank s perspective,
liquidity is the
